3 GREAT CAFES in one town!!!
We are on a whirlwind tour of UK and luckily came across these cafes. for brunch we tried George and Danver, for a mid-afternnoon break we tried George and David, and in the late afternoon we dashed into George and Delila. ICE CREAM HEAVEN…
it’s all homemade using natural ingredients. All sandwiches are made on bagels (if you don’t like bagels you’re out of luck)...the bagels are not quite as good as you find in NYC but pretty good. Very nice atmosphere. Apparently George & Delila is the most recent shop of the 3 and in several respects it’s the nicest (very smart interior and particularly on-the-ball staff); that said George and Danver (opposite Christ Church College) is located in a beautiful stone building and they have done a nice job with wood features inside and in restoring/maintaining other aspects of the old building (e.g. plaster ceiling design). Anyway: Good Food and Coffee…and Great Ice Cream (lot’s of creative flavors). Definitely worth a visit.
